Clitheroe Triathlon, August 22nd 2010
Clitheroe Triathlon
Sunday August 22nd 2010
400m / 30k / 9k
 
 
The Clitheroe Triathlon takes place from Ribblesdale Swimming Pool and the route is both scenic and challenging ! This is a great race if you enjoy rolling country lanes with a few challenging climbs. Competitors can sign up as a solo entrant or enter as a relay team of three and choose a discipline each
 
The swim:
 
Swimmers start from 8:00am through to 12:00pm based upon ability level and will complete 16 lengths of a 25m pool. There will be 3 people in each lane at any given time. When you enter, your estimated swim time will be used to calculate your swim start time, faster swimmers will start later in the morning and slower swimmers will start earlier. You will be provided with a swim cap and lane counters will ensure that you complete the distance and inform you how many lengths you have completed should you lose count. Before the swim you will be briefed regarding the direction on the lane and will be asked to swim clockwise or anti-clockwise.
 
The bike:
 
The 30k bike course provides great views of the Lancashire countryside. Leaving the leisure centre you will head out through Bashall Eaves in Bowland before returning via the tough climb over Longridge Fell. Your bicycle should be roadworthy and it is compulsory to wear a recognised cycle helmet, this event is non-drafting (you cannot ride directly behind another competitor to shelter from the wind) and you must not ride 2 abreast on the road. The course is not closed to traffic and you should follow the highway code at all times, riding responsibly.
 
The run:
 
The 9k run leaves the leisure centre and heads towards Bashall Eaves before completing a circular loop back to the finish line and takes place on quiet country lanes.
 
The transition area:
 
The transition area is situated just outside the pool and all of your race equipment must be left within this are, no clothing or equipment can be left on poolside. You must exit the pool fire exit into transition before changing into cycle clothing and starting the ride. Upon returning you should then rack your bicycle before changing into your run clothing and starting the run. The finish line is adjacent to the transition area. The event is insures by the British Triathlon Federation and will take place according to their rules and regulations, for information go to www.britishtriathlon.org
 
What to do on the day:
 
On the day you should register an hour before your start time, you will be given an electronic chip which wraps around your ankle, 2 race numbers for rear of your cycle top and front of your run top (number belts allowed) and 2 numbered stickers for your helmet and your bike.
 
You must show your numbers before racking your bike in the transition area, the racking will be numbered and you should place your bike in the correct position. Once you have placed your cycle and run clothing with your bicycle, all other equipment must be removed from transition area to minimise disruption for other competitors.
 
There will be a briefing 10 minutes before your swim start on the poolside. Please do not be late for this briefing as it may contain important changes to the event which may affect you.
 
What happens following the event?
 
All finishers collect a race T-Shirt at the finish line and prizes will be awarded at the race presentation after the last person has completed the course. Refreshments will be available on the day and a full results service will be provided.
